  • I tried a few Barre Mixed Level classes at the Queen Street location when they opened last year and loved them, but the location was just too far from me. Needless to say, I was so excited when I heard they were opening a midtown location in my area (Yonge/Eglinton), and checked them out on opening weekend. I took an introductory level class - BarreBasics - and had an amazing time. Marissa, the instructor, was so vibrant and full of energy you couldn't help but get excited about every move we did. The class itself, despite being a basic class, was still fast paced and challenging enough that you worked up a sweat and got a great workout, but had the added benefit of very specific instructions, examples, and help with each element, from wide-legged squats to lunges on the barre. The studio itself is clean and bright, though it's considerably smaller than the Queen Street location, but there's still enough room in the smaller studio for 18 people to take a class (mostly) comfortably. However, since the space is somewhat small there was no room for a spin studio for their SpinBarre classes. My only complaint is the price - it's not cheap at $21 per class - but it is comparable to many of the Yoga and Pilates studios in the city. They do offer discounts if you buy multiple classes, or you can get a membership. If you're new, you can take advantage of their newbie special, and your first class will only be $10. Despite the high pricetag, I'll definitely be back a number of times.
